Wondering how improvisation can help you as an actor? Trying to decide where to study? Four of the top training centers in Los Angeles gather on one panel to discuss all things improv. The night ends with each of the schools taking 10 minutes on our stage to show the audience an exercise, play a game, have alumni perform, or whatever the school wants! In the spirit of improv, we won't know until we see it.

Panelists include Joshua Funk from The Second City, David Jahn from The Groundlings, Seth Weitberg from iO West, and Joe Wengert from Upright Citizens Brigade. The moderator is Jessica Gardner, Features Writer, Back Stage.

The panel takes place on Wednesday, September 14, at 7:30 p.m. at SAG Foundation Actors Center, 5757 Wilshire Blvd., Mezzanine Level, Los Angeles, CA.
